Ticket: RestockRoute planner failing on boot in the Harvale depot environment. Root cause: env file copied from the demo cluster, so the planner points at fake vending telemetry and schedules zero restocks. Fix: replace demo values with production ones for the Harvale region. DB host and region vars already corrected. Only missing piece is the planner's API credential, which goes on the next line.

vault entry, yahif-yajep: COURIER_KEY29=b802bdf8034096b65a51c6ba5abe2

## Contrast Audit — Nightglass Portal

If the automated contrast audit fails overnight, don't page design. Re-run the scanner against the staging theme first; most failures are stale token caches. Flush the theme cache, rerun, and compare against the last green report. Persistent failures under 4.5:1 get logged to the audit results database for the morning triage queue. Connect to it with the string below.

replica DSN, yahog-kawig: redis://istox_svc:um@db-8a67.halixforge.test:5432/frawyn

RUNBOOK — Stage Props, Lantern Road Tour

The prop crates for the Lantern Road touring show move venue-to-venue on a tight overnight schedule. Crates are numbered and travel as a full set — never split the load. Driver checks the crate count against the tour sheet before rolling. Keep the tail-lift clear for the big scenery flats. Hand-over works like this.

handover note for yagef-bagep: the drudor pelius courier leaves the kasdor zorvan norir ledger at gate 8016 under passcode 755406